From an orange grove to a Jacksonville suburb
The North Florida enclave of Fruit Cove, originally an orange grove along the St. Johns River, has steadily developed into a community of over 30,000 living comfortably in the suburbs of Jacksonville. “It’s a little bit more like old Florida; there are lots of trees and a lot of green,” says Erica Jolles, a real estate agent with Round Table Realty.

Wide Selection and low HOA activity
The median price for homes here is $557,000, higher than Florida’s and the national median. Jolles says that home styles are “definitely not cookie-cutter.” Residences can vary from ranch to Mediterranean-inspired, as well as New Traditional and Craftsman styles. There is also a selection of Colonial Revival mansions on the river. Jolles says Fruit Cove has very little HOA activity, with most properties not being part of any association. Workshops or other small businesses on private properties are found throughout the city. She also noted that people moving to the area include a mix of retirees and those looking to get away from larger subdivisions.

Greenspaces and golfing
Next to the St. Johns River is Alpine Groves Park. The park has over 50 acres and features miles of trails, fishing spots and a restored 19th-century house. Further inland is Julington Creek Plantation Park, which has a football field, several grass multipurpose fields and a playground. Julington Creek Golf Club is a public course in Fruit Cove that underwent a substantial renovation in 2022. Other courses can be found in St. John’s County and nearby St. Augustine.

Public and private school options
Fruit Cove’s students are served by the A-rated St. John’s County School District, the third-best school district in Florida according to Niche. San Juan del Rio Catholic School is also based in Fruit Cove, and has an A rating, but has an annual tuition rate of $8,700. St. Johns River State College is across the river in Lakeside, while other universities, such as the University of North Florida, are in Jacksonville.

Dine and shop in Julington Creek
The majority of the shopping and dining destinations in Fruit Cove are found to the north at the intersection of State Road 13 and Race Track Road in Julington Creek Plantation, which is also designated as a community development district. The area has a mix of chain and local selections, including Bella Vista, a family-owned and operated Italian restaurant. The Julington Creek Fish House & Oyster Company has freshly caught seafood and serves brunch, while Iggy’s Grill and Bar consistently hosts live music and special events. Julington Creek Plantation has several shopping plazas, including a Publix grocery store and a Walmart neighborhood market. A second Publix is further to the east on Race Track Road. Several primary care facilities are in Julington Creek, while HCA Florida has an emergency facility to the east on Race Track Road.

Connections to Jacksonville
State Route 13 directly connects to Jacksonville, over 20 miles to the north, and to St. Augustine to the southeast. A connection to Interstate 95 is also nearby. The closest airport to Fruit Cove is Jacksonville International Airport, which is 40 miles to the north.

Crime and hurricane activity in Fruit Cove
Information on crime in Fruit Cove and St. John’s County was not readily available. Residents should be wary of hurricane activity, as several major hurricanes made landfall in St. Johns County in 2022, but the county does maintain a warning system for residents.

On average, homes in Fruit Cove, FL sell after 93 days on the market compared to the national average of 53 days. The median sale price for homes in Fruit Cove, FL over the last 12 months is $700,000, up 20% from the median home sale price over the previous 12 months.
